Logan Paul has commented his and Ricochet's botched 'Spanish Fly' through a table from Saturday's WWE Money in the Bank premium live event.



The high-risk spot left Paul with some nasty cuts on his back, but that didn't stop him from having a great weekend. He got engaged the following day to model Nina Agdal at a $2,400-per-night resort at Italy's Lake Como.

Paul discussed the Spanish Fly spot on the latest episode of his ImPAULsive Podcast:

"There was a botched move. There was a botched move with the dangerous landing. I walked away this time relatively unscathed. I got some scrapes and bruises but no major tweaks or pulls, but Ricochet and I was supposed to do what's called the Spanish fly off the top rope.

So one of our legs is on the rope, one of our legs is on the ladder, and we were supposed to hit it at the same time. And when he hit that rope, it was before me, so he moved it so I slipped down all the way to the bottom.

Keep in mind, I'm a noob. I don't really know what I'm doing out there, so when stuff goes wrong, I don't really know how to improv. So in my head I'm like, 'How is this guy.. this is fucked. We fucked this up. How is this guy going to do this? Is he even going to do this?'

Our legs are all twisted like this. I'm looking at him I'm like oh motherfucker is still trying to send this shit. I'm not even ready. His feet are even planted off the second rope, just hooks a backflip, I'm like 'Alright...' I went crashing through the table, scraped my shoulder. I hit my head on the thing. I'm fine, no concussions or anything, but it's just a wild sport, man."


Paul will get another chance to show Ricochet what he's made of. After Ricochet called him out on Monday's Raw, the two will come face-to-face next week.
